Lisa H. Bishop, Vice President, Training and Clinical Development, works with the Chief Medical Officer and the administrative leadership team to plan, lead and evaluate the training and education programs for all team members, including annual and on-going support. She works with company leaders to ensure clinical development and education competencies meet or exceed industry best practices and assists members to ensure new partnerships, acquisitions, and/or mergers are implemented in a manner to meet accreditation standards. She received her Doctor of Nursing Practice from Samford University in Birmingham, AL and her Master of Science in Nursing from Mississippi University for Women. She received her Master’s in Healthcare Administration from Walden University where she was on the graduate faculty for 10 years. She is a Family Nurse Practitioner and prior to joining Premier in 2016, she was on the faculty of Fran University and has served as a primary care provider in North Mississippi and for the Veterans Administration. Dr. Bishop has over 25 years of clinical experience, including 13 years in Urgent Care. She is a member of the Urgent Care Association (UCA). She is a Fellow in the College of Urgent Care Medicine and serves on its Board of Directors.
